During the recent earnings call, Arena Group management addressed the Q1 2026 results, noting a reported loss of $0.06 per share. The leadership team highlighted that this quarter’s performance reflects ongoing investments in content strategy and technology platforms, particularly within their digital media properties. While specific revenue figures were not disclosed in the release, executives emphasized progress on operational initiatives, including the expansion of their sports and lifestyle verticals, which they believe could strengthen audience engagement and advertiser interest over time. Management discussed key business drivers, pointing to a focus on diversifying revenue streams beyond traditional advertising, such as licensing and events, though these areas are still in early stages. Operational highlights included efforts to streamline cost structures, with the company citing improved efficiency in content production and distribution. Executives also noted that recent partnerships and content syndication deals may provide a tailwind for future quarters, though they cautioned that market conditions remain dynamic. Overall, the commentary reflected a measured outlook, with management reiterating their commitment to driving long-term value while acknowledging the challenges of a competitive digital landscape. The team signaled that they are closely monitoring subscriber trends and audience metrics, which they view as leading indicators of potential revenue growth. For the upcoming quarters, Arena Group management has provided cautious forward guidance, focusing on operational efficiency and strategic investments. Executives indicated that while the first quarter reflected a net loss of $0.06 per share, the company anticipates sequential improvement in revenue as it ramps its core digital media and subscription offerings. The outlook suggests that recent cost-reduction initiatives may begin to positively impact margins in the near term, though management refrained from providing specific quantitative targets given ongoing market uncertainty. The company expects to continue investing in content creation and technology infrastructure, which could weigh on profitability in the immediate future. However, executives expressed confidence that these investments would position Arena Group for sustained growth in the latter half of the fiscal year. Additionally, the company plans to explore new advertising partnerships and expand its audience reach, potentially driving higher engagement metrics. While no explicit earnings per share guidance was provided, the tone of the call suggested that management remains focused on balancing growth with fiscal discipline. Analysts will be watching for signs of revenue acceleration and narrowing losses in the next quarterly update. The market’s response to Arena Group’s first-quarter 2026 earnings has been notably negative, with shares falling in the wake of the report. The adjusted loss per share of -$0.06 fell short of analyst expectations, though no revenue figure was provided, complicating the narrative. Investors appeared to focus on the widening bottom-line shortfall, reacting with a sharp sell-off that pushed the stock toward recent lows. Trading volume was elevated as participants reassessed the company’s near-term trajectory. Analysts have begun trimming their forward estimates, citing persistent operational headwinds and the absence of a clear revenue catalyst in the quarter. Several sell-side notes emphasized that the loss per share came in worse than the consensus range, raising concerns about cost control and the pace of the restructuring plan. While some observers noted that Arena Group’s digital media assets could provide long-term value, the immediate market reaction suggests diminishing confidence in management’s ability to execute on profitability. The stock price implications remain uncertain, as the company may need to deliver a concrete path to breakeven before sentiment shifts. In the near term, shares could continue to face pressure unless the upcoming investor day or strategic updates offer a more compelling narrative.
